Output 523dd8778a8efee963ed7c7a0ce0326142a6736587d65a7feff3262129f136c4:2

value
673554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7fcd4595338e9fe9261e44caa53662bdc7cd041 OP_EQUALVERIFY OP_CHECKSIG
address
1HmqY1LP38VAdux8qXvCKKSjjpLB7Ac243
transaction
523dd8778a8efee963ed7c7a0ce0326142a6736587d65a7feff3262129f136c4
spent
true